Transaction bfbc720c5291479428e6e88db78ade5978a3a7c23047f84cd26ece5e29de355b
1 Input
1 Output
-
bfbc720c5291479428e6e88db78ade5978a3a7c23047f84cd26ece5e29de355b:0
- value
- 573963
- script pubkey
- OP_0 OP_PUSHBYTES_20 3de7b37c308da2d4deb96c76a09af668c39b85a2
- address
- bc1q8hnmxlps3k3dfh4ed3m2pxhkdrpehpdzx8u8ns